• M16 Artspace Environmental Artist in Residence Application

    M16 Artspace is excited to announce its Environmental Artist in Residence program, sponsored by Thomas Boulton, in 2025!

  • ENVIRONMENTAL ARTIST IN RESIDENCE PROPOSAL

    Applicants are invited to submit proposals that will utilise a nine-month M16 Artspace Studio Residency, and exhibition at M16 in 2026, to create a body of artwork that examines and engages with the core principles of environmental sustainability.
